欢迎访问ic37.com |
会员登录 免费注册
发布采购

PMC-2/11/02/001/01/00/03/00/00

日期:2018-10-9类别:会员资讯 阅读:448 (来源:互联网)
公司:
漳州鼎晟达自动化设备有限公司
联系人:
林朝艺
手机:
18105962758
电话:
18105962758
传真:
86-0596-3119658
QQ:
2880842795
地址:
漳州市漳浦县金浦花园1-302
摘要:ELAU Schneider Electric PMC-2/11/02/001/01/00/03/00/00 13130222-007

UDB中四个PLD(每个UDB有2个)的大多数乘积项可用于控制数据通路,生成中断,提供状态和控制功能,但这也使用了这种低成本微控制器中一半的UDB资源。

  接下来的工作是明确这一附加硬件能为设计节省多少CPU开销。以1,000个LED组成的阵列为例,其刷新频率为30Hz。如果设计使用固件对接口进行位拆裂操作,会差不多占用100%的CPU资源。使用PSoC器件中的可编程硬件仍然可以做到每30微秒中断一次,虽然这也是较重的负荷,但运行在48MHZ的ARMCortex-M0足以应付。为测试CPU开销,我创建了一个简单的环路,以大约30Hz的频率刷新显示器。在主环路中,我触发了一个引脚,然后使用示波器计算40毫秒内的触发数量。然后我禁用中断,再次运行项目,并比较结果。与使用固件中的位拆裂造成的几乎100%的CPU占用相比,持续显示刷新只占用大约12%的CPU资源。这样另外88%的CPU周期可用于外部通信和用户界面。如果为设计添加DMA,该开销可能会从12%下降到2%或更低。我使用的最廉价PSoC(约1美元)只包含UDB但未包含DMA,不过一些较大型的部件确实内置有DMA。

  随后我实际制作了一个由60x16个LED(960个LED)网格组成的真正RGBLED板,用于测试该组件。该组件的运行符合预期,可用作显示基本的直线、矩形、圆圈以及文本的图形界面
图11使用960个RGBLED制作的广告牌

  无论是大型LED板还是简单的定制界面,部分内部可编程硬件会给设计性能造成重大影响。不是每一种定制界面都需要多字节FIFO或全硬件状态机,但拥有这种灵活性能为您提供更多设计选择、提高性能,或是让现有设计迅速适合产品需求。

诚信经营,质量为首,诚信至上,漳州鼎晟达自动化设备有限公司竭诚为您服务
***************  咨询热线:18105962758(林工)*******************
联系人:林朝艺(销售经理)                                         
手机      :18105962758
QQ        :2880842795                        
邮箱      :2880842795@qq.com
传真      :0596-3119658(请备注林工收)                                         
-----------------------------------------------------------------------------
【本公司主营产品】
1:Invensys Foxboro(福克斯波罗):Westinghouse(西屋)Reliance瑞恩ABB:、Siemens(西门子):Siemens MOORE,
2:GE FANUC(GE发那科):模块、Yaskawa(安川):伺服控制器、Bosch Rexroth(博世力士乐)Woodward(伍德沃德)英维斯(TRICONEX)
3:Rockwell Allen-Bradley: Reliance瑞恩、贝加莱(B&R), 欧姆龙(OMRON),  KEBA, 安川(YASKAWA) 等品牌的停产备件。
-----------------------------------------------------------------------------
IC600LX612K 
IC600CB500A 
IC693MDL240 
IC600BF831K 
IC600BF942K
IC600CB503L
IC697MDL340 
IC600CB516L 
IC697HSC700
IC600BF904K
IC693CPU331RR (2514)
IC610CHS130A
IC610-CCM105D 
IC610-CHS110A
IC610-CPU106B 
IC693MDL752
IC693MDL752D
IC752WBB205-DB
IC693PCM301J
IC610-MDL110B 
IC610-MDL125B
IC610-MDL180A 
IC693ALG221
IC693ALG221E 
IC693ALG221
IC693ALG221G 
IC693CPU331-AA 
IC693CPU331AA 9030
IC609TCU100B
IC693CHS391M 
IC693ALG220 
IC693ALG220
IC693CHS391D 
IC693PWR321Y 
IC693CPU311U (PLC1327)
IC690CBL701A
IC693BEM331
IC693BEM331 
IC693MDL340
IC697CPU772 
IC697CPU772
IC697CMM741 
IC697CMM741
IC697MDL750
IC630CCM300
IC630CCM300A
IC3600SBMB 
IC3600SBMB
IC610MSC105A
IC693MDL645 
IC693MDL940 
IC693MDR390
IC693PWR321U 
IC697MDL653 
IC697-PCM711K 
IC697PCM711K
IC697-PWR711H 
IC697PWR711H
IC600BF810K
IC692MDR541C
IC600BF804K
IC670PBI001-CG 
IC693CPU351-FN 
IC630CCM311 
IC630CCM311A 
IC600BF804K
IC600CB502D 
IC600YB810A 
IC600CB504A 
IC600PM503K 
IC693PWR330 
IC610MDL105B
IC610MDL105
IC-610-MDL-105
IC752DSX000-DC
IC697MDL750 
IC670PBI001-BE
IC630MDL302 
IC630MDL302A
IC600CB524M 
IC600BF904K
IC600YB800B 
IC600CB524K
IC630MDL303
IC630MDL303A
IC697PWR710J
IC630MDL304A
IC300DIM210C 
IC630MDL304
IC697MDL753 
IC693MDL940F 
IC693PWR321U 
IC697CMM711P
IC693UDR005RP1 
IC200MDL650C 
IC697CMM741
IC800SDM100M2KE25C
IC693CPU341N
IC630MDL306 
IC600YB929A
IC693MDL340D
IC630MDL306A 
IC693MDL645D
IC693CPU311S


IC693CHS398H
IC693CHS399G
IC693CMM302B
IC693CMM311J
IC693CMM311J OU N K
IC693CMM321-EE EF
IC693CMM321-EF AA DE
IC693CMM321-JK GH
IC647AUR050 
IC647AUR100 
IC647BME301  
IC647BR3C 
IC647BR3M 
IC647CBL708 
IC647CGMS00 
IC647CGMS35  
IC647CGMV00 
IC647CSCEMK 
IC647DMC001 
IC647DMC003 
IC647DMC005  
IC647DMC010 
IC647DMC020 
IC647DMC050 
IC647DMC100  
IC647DMC200 
IC647DMS001 
IC647DMS003 
IC647DMS005  
IC647DMS010 
IC647DMS025 
IC647DNP000 
IC647DNP001 
IC647DNP005  
IC647DNP010 
IC647DNP050 
IC647EGDC 
IC647EGDM  
IC647EIMC 
IC647EIMM 
IC647EURC 
IC647EURM 
IC647FSHC  
IC647FSHM 
IC647G90C 
IC647G90M 
IC647GE6C  
IC647GE6M 
IC647GE9C 
IC647GE9M 
IC647GEFC  
IC647GEFM 
IC647GESC 
IC647GESM 
IC647GIOC 
IC647GIOM  
IC647GS2PDR 
IC647HITC 
IC647HITM 
IC647I3EC  
IC647I3EM 
IC647IFCLNTCDVC 
IC647IFCLNTCDVK 
IC647IFCLNTCDVM 
IC647IFCLNTCRNC  
IC647IFCLNTCRNK 
IC647IFCLNTCRNM